Boise vs Spokane: which has better splash pads?
Quick answer
Boise has slightly more pads (~10 vs Spokane's ~8) and a hotter summer that demands them. Spokane's Riverfront Park Looff Carrousel pad is iconic, while Boise's Julia Davis and Esther Simplot pads anchor the Boise River Greenbelt.
Side by side
- Boise: Julia Davis Park, Esther Simplot Park, Ann Morrison, Ivywild.
- Spokane: Riverfront Park, Manito Park, Liberty Park, Cannon Hill.
- Season: Boise ~140 days; Spokane ~120.
- Pricing: free at all listed pads.
- Spokane's Riverfront pad pairs with the famous Looff Carrousel — combo family stop.
Verdict
Boise wins on count and season length; Spokane wins on Riverfront's signature combo.
